BA8522RFV-E2 Specifications

Part Number BA8522RFV-E2
Part Status Active
Amplifier Type General Purpose
Number of Circuits 2
Output Type -
Slew Rate 3 V/µs
Gain Bandwidth Product 6MHz
-3db Bandwidth -
Current - Input Bias 50nA
Voltage - Input Offset 100µV
Current - Supply 5.5mA
Current - Output / Channel 50mA
Voltage - Supply, Single/Dual (±) 4 V ~ 32 V, ±2 V ~ 16 V
Operating Temperature -40°C ~ 105°C
Mounting Type Surface Mount
Package / Case 8-LSSOP (0.173", 4.40mm Width)
Supplier Device Package 8-SSOPB
